MUMBAI, India, March 13 -- Intellectual Property India has published a patent application (202641024492 A) filed by Meenakshi Academy Of Higher Education And Research, Chennai, Tamil Nadu, on March 2, for 'a system and method for smart hospital resource and workflow optimization.'
Inventor(s) include Logeswari J; Dr. Meyyammai C. T.; Victor Devasirvadham; and Durga B.
The application for the patent was published on March 13, under issue no. 11/2026.
According to the abstract released by the Intellectual Property India: "A System and Method for Smart Hospital Resource and Workflow Optimization The present disclosure relates to a system and method for optimizing hospital resources and workflows through real-time telemetry acquisition, dynamic digital twin simulation, and autonomous infrastructure orchestration. The system has at least one processor that works with memory, a telemetry acquisition module that gathers operational data from hospital devices like beds, ventilators, RFID trackers, environmental sensors, and wearable monitors, a digital twin simulation engine that makes a constantly updated computational model of hospital resources, and an AI-based prediction engine that finds workflow bottlenecks and resource shortages. An autonomous resource orchestration controller creates executable control signals that change the schedules for beds, ventilators, staff, and operating rooms in real time. For emergency triage, a bio-priority index is calculated, and an energy-aware optimization module cuts down on the power used by equipment. Reinforcement learning mechanisms constantly improve allocation strategies. This makes it possible to optimize hospitals in a closed loop with hardware integration, resulting in measurable improvements in efficiency and response time."
